Transaction fc60e116a88d786f8652036d561205c3f5ad3e37eb1edca4266fd77a4e3ce0b8
1 Input
1 Output
-
fc60e116a88d786f8652036d561205c3f5ad3e37eb1edca4266fd77a4e3ce0b8:0
- value
- 31332856
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 758b512eaf774e24ee7db49e0654e7dc12a8c8a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BiWxNJTz4TxtweB3CCYqKsg7GWhVx9ncD